What to Eat
Nuremberg is known for its delicious food. Here are some of the must-try dishes:
- Nuremberg Rostbratwürste: These small, grilled sausages are the city's signature dish.
- Lebkuchen: These gingerbread cookies are a popular souvenir from Nuremberg.
- Schäufele: This roasted pork shoulder is a hearty and flavorful dish.
Where to Go
Nuremberg is a beautiful city with a rich history. Here are some of the top tourist attractions:
- Nuremberg Castle: This imposing castle is one of the city's most iconic landmarks.
- St. Lorenz Church: This Gothic church is known for its beautiful stained glass windows.
- German National Museum: This museum houses a vast collection of German art and history.
